    • Transcription has become increasingly important in the US due to the rise of remote work, online learning, and content creation. As more people consume media on-demand, businesses and organizations are seeking ways to make their content more accessible and engaging.   • Transcription accuracy can vary depending on the method used, the quality of the audio or video file, and the level of expertise of the transcriber. While automated transcription can achieve high accuracy rates, human transcription is often more accurate.
